When a foreign court, arbitral tribunal, or instructing counsel encounters a question governed by Peruvian law, translation alone is not enough. A document translated into English may explain its words — but not its legal consequences under Peruvian civil law, registry practice, succession rules, or notarial requirements.
This guide explains when expert evidence on Peruvian law is necessary, what a reliable expert report should contain, and what foreign lawyers must verify before relying on assumptions about Peruvian law in cross-border matters.

In cross-border legal matters, the challenge is not only translating Peruvian documents — it is translating the Peruvian legal system itself so that foreign lawyers, courts, and practitioners can make informed decisions.
A foreign will, trust, power of attorney, registry certificate, or court judgment may produce legal consequences in Peru that differ significantly from what the issuing jurisdiction intended. These publications address that gap directly.
